1 day agoIndian Rupee Hits Record Low of 89.85 Against U.S. Dollar

The Indian Rupee dropped 32 paise in early trade, hitting an all-time low of 89.85 against the U.S. Dollar. The sharp decline is attributed to a strengthening dollar, rising global inflationary pressures, and concerns over India's current account deficit. Analysts suggest the rupee may remain under pressure if the global economic outlook worsens.
